I'm hoping that you have a temp gauge and hygrometer to measure temp and humidity in their enclosures. Not having these devices and just assuming because the area you live in is correct for the frogs and to assume that it makes the evironment in their enclosures correct can be a fatal mistake. Also as both Mark and Jessica said meal worms are NOT supposed to be given as a staple diet nor fish or frogs. Especially not wild caught frogs and fish. Way too risky and drastically threatens your frogs health. Try not to stress the Albino if he/she isn't eating as it will just make things worse. try the food items that Mark and Jessica mentioned and make sure the food items you are feeding your frogs is of proper size. The item should be at least 1/4 the length of the frog excluding worms as length is most defintly longer than the frog but thickness will be small.
